The SOS game is a classic strategy puzzle traditionally played with pen and paper. Now modernized as SOS Mania, it remains one of the most engaging brain teasers for two or more players.
The goal is to create the most "SOS" sequences on the grid. Sequences can be formed horizontally, vertically, or diagonally.
While Traditionally played on a 3x3 or 4x4 grid, SOS Mania uses an expanded 9x9 grid to allow for more complex strategic maneuvers and longer-lasting battles.
The game ends when the entire grid is filled. The player with the highest total score of SOS sequences is declared the winner.
Unlike Tic-Tac-Toe, SOS requires both offensive and defensive thinking. You must balance trying to score while ensuring you don't accidentally set up an "SOS" for your opponent!
